在AI时代,前端开发面临着前所未有的挑战和机遇。一方面,日益复杂的应用需求和用户体验期望推动着前端技术不断演进,增加了开发的复杂度;另一方面,AI技术的快速发展为前端开发带来了效率提升的巨大潜力。为了应对这些挑战,并充分利用AI带来的机遇,掌握并应用AI写代码工具和框架变得至关重要。本文将探讨一些主流的AI前端开发工具和框架,并提供学习路径建议,最终以ScriptEcho为例,深入分析AI如何提升前端开发效率。
AI时代的前端开发:挑战与机遇并存
.......
现代前端开发不再仅仅是简单的HTML、CSS和JavaScript的组合。复杂的交互效果、跨平台兼容性、以及对性能和安全性的更高要求,都使得前端开发变得越来越复杂。同时,市场对高质量、高效率的交付有着更高的要求,这无疑给前端开发者带来了巨大的压力。然而,AI技术的兴起也为前端开发带来了新的机遇。AI驱动的工具和框架可以自动化许多重复性的任务,减少代码编写量,提高开发效率,从而帮助开发者专注于更具创造性的工作。
AI前端开发工具与框架的学习与应用
2.1 常用AI前端开发工具与框架推荐及分析
目前市场上涌现出许多优秀的AI前端开发工具和框架。这里,我们选择两个具有代表性的工具进行分析:
-
基于大模型的代码生成工具: 这类工具通常集成在大模型平台中,可以直接通过自然语言描述或设计图生成代码。其优点是易于上手,能够快速生成简单的代码片段,节省开发时间。缺点是生成的代码可能不够精细,需要开发者进行一定的调整和优化,而且对复杂的逻辑处理能力相对较弱。 例如,一些基于GPT模型的代码生成插件,可以在主流IDE中直接使用。
-
基于特定框架的AI辅助工具: 这类工具通常针对特定的前端框架(如React、Vue、Angular)进行优化,能够更好地理解框架的语法和规范,生成更符合规范的代码。其优点是生成的代码质量更高,更易于维护和扩展。缺点是学习成本可能较高,需要开发者对目标框架有一定的了解。 一些工具会提供预设的组件库和模板,方便开发者快速搭建页面。
.......
选择合适的AI前端开发工具需要根据项目需求和自身技术水平进行权衡。对于简单的项目或快速原型开发,基于大模型的代码生成工具可能更合适;而对于复杂的项目或需要高代码质量的场景,基于特定框架的AI辅助工具则更具优势。
2.2 学习路径建议
学习AI前端开发工具和框架,并非一蹴而就。根据学习阶段,可以制定不同的学习路径:
-
入门阶段: 首先学习前端基础知识(HTML、CSS、JavaScript),然后选择一款易于上手的AI代码生成工具,进行简单的实践,例如生成简单的页面元素或组件。 可以参考一些在线教程和文档,例如一些平台提供的入门课程。
-
进阶阶段: 深入学习目标框架的原理和规范,掌握常用的组件和API,并学习如何使用AI工具生成更复杂的代码。 可以参与一些开源项目,或者尝试使用AI工具构建一个完整的应用。 积极参与相关的社区和论坛,与其他开发者交流经验。
掌握核心概念和积累实践经验是学习AI前端开发工具和框架的关键。 不要害怕犯错,通过不断的实践和总结,才能真正掌握这些工具的使用方法,并将其应用到实际项目中。
2.3 案例分析:ScriptEcho——提升前端开发效率的利器
ScriptEcho是一款基于大模型AI技术的前端代码生成工具,它能够显著提升前端开发效率。其核心功能包括:
-
设计图/草图/文字描述生成代码: 开发者可以上传设计图、手绘草图,或者直接用自然语言描述页面结构和样式,ScriptEcho就能自动生成相应的代码。这极大简化了从设计到代码的转换过程,节省了大量时间。
-
主题式生成功能: ScriptEcho支持多种流行的UI框架,如Ant Design、Vant、Vuetify、Element Plus和uniapp等。开发者可以选择预设的主题风格,快速生成符合设计规范的代码,确保项目的一致性和美观性。
-
组件库选择与定制: ScriptEcho集成了丰富的组件库,开发者可以选择合适的组件,并根据需要进行定制,进一步提升开发效率。
-
模型微调: ScriptEcho允许开发者根据自身需求对模型进行微调,使其更好地理解项目规范和代码风格,生成更符合预期效果的代码。
ScriptEcho的这些功能完美地契合了前端开发中提高效率的需求。例如,在开发一个电商网站时,开发者可以使用ScriptEcho快速生成产品列表页面、商品详情页面等,并根据需要调整样式和功能。通过自动化代码生成,开发者可以将更多精力放在业务逻辑和用户体验的优化上,从而提升整体开发效率和产品质量。 ScriptEcho的强大之处在于它不仅仅是一个简单的代码生成器,而是一个智能化的开发助手,它能够理解开发者的意图,并提供相应的帮助。
结论
AI前端开发工具和框架的应用,是前端开发未来发展的必然趋势。它们不仅能够显著提升开发效率,缩短开发周期,降低开发成本,还能提高代码质量,提升用户体验。 ScriptEcho等工具的出现,更是为前端开发者带来了巨大的便利。
未来,AI前端开发将朝着更智能化、更个性化、更协作化的方向发展。更强大的代码生成能力、更完善的组件库、更智能化的错误检测和修复功能,以及更便捷的团队协作工具,都将成为AI前端开发的重点发展方向。
我们鼓励各位开发者积极探索和尝试AI前端开发工具和框架,拥抱AI技术带来的机遇,提升自身技术水平,从而在日益激烈的竞争中脱颖而出。 学习和应用AI前端开发工具,将成为每一位前端工程师提升自身竞争力的重要途径。
#AI写代码工具 #AI代码工貝 #AI写代码软件 #AI代码生成器 #AI编程助手 #AI编程软件 #AI人工智能编程代码
#AI生成代码 #AI代码生成 #AI生成前端页面 #AI生成uniapp
本文由ScriptEcho平台提供技术支持
欢迎添加:scriptecho-helper